# Reviewers: please read before approving changes to this block.
# A canary is promoted only when all three gates pass: error rate
# under 0.4% over a rolling 15-minute window, p99 latency within
# 1.2x of the stable cohort, and zero failed health probes across
# the Mirefield region. Gate evaluations are recorded for audit,
# and the pipeline refuses promotion if the audit write fails.
# The gate-audit records live in a dedicated database, reachable
# via the connection string defined on the next line.

warehouse DSN: mssql://rusdor_svc:0FSWCn9@db-951a.paliqforge.local:5432/ulawyn

// REINDEX_BATCH_CAP limits docs per shard pass in the Tallowfield
// nightly search reindex. Raising it starves the ingest queue;
// lowering it overruns the maintenance window. 5000 is the tested
// sweet spot. Change only with a soak run. Verified against the
// build noted below.

session token of bawif-hahog = htk6_ac5981

Ticket: Staging env misconfigured for Siftgate bloom filter

The bloom layer in front of the Pellet KV store is rejecting all lookups in staging because the env file was copied from the dev template without credentials. False-positive tuning values are fine; only the auth line is missing. To unblock the weekly demo, the Pellet admission secret must be set on the following line.

env line for yaguf-fajop: LEDGER_TOKEN13=fb08984397349

### Step 4: Spreadsheet Export Memory Fix — Tallowgrid 3.2

The export worker now streams rows instead of buffering full workbooks. Peak memory drops from ~6 GB to under 400 MB on the Harwick dataset. Before promoting, run the export benchmark twice and confirm the second run stays under the threshold; the first run warms the row cache. Deprecated XLS output is removed — notify downstream consumers. Benchmarks read from the reporting replica; connect to it using the connection string below.

primary connection of tajeg-tajop = postgresql://julax_svc:DI@db-e7f3.kelvidyn.corp:5432/rusdor